1. Immerse Yourself in the Sacred Pushkar Lake
Begin your spiritual journey with a visit to the revered Pushkar Lake, a focal point of Pushkar Highlights. This sacred lake is believed to have been created when Lord Brahma dropped a lotus flower. Take a leisurely stroll around the ghats, observe the devotees performing their rituals, and experience the serene atmosphere. Consider a peaceful boat ride on the lake to fully appreciate its beauty and tranquility. 2. Seek Blessings at the Brahma Temple
A visit to Pushkar is incomplete without seeking blessings at the revered Brahma Temple, one of the few temples dedicated to Lord Brahma in the world. This 1-2 hour experience offers deep insight into Hindu mythology and the significance of Brahma. The temple's architecture, marked by its red spire and the image of a Hans (goose), is truly captivating. Furthermore, the serene atmosphere within the temple provides a peaceful contrast to the bustling town outside. 3. Witness the Evening Aarti Ceremony
One of the most enchanting Pushkar Highlights is the Evening Aarti ceremony at Pushkar Lake. As the sun begins to set, the lake transforms into a spectacle of vibrant colors and spiritual energy. Priests perform the aarti, a Hindu ritual of worship, with lamps, incense, and chanting. The reflection of the lamps on the water, combined with the rhythmic sounds of the bells and mantras, creates a mesmerizing atmosphere. It’s a must-see for anyone seeking a deep cultural experience. 6. Enjoy Panoramic Views from Savitri Temple
For breathtaking panoramic views of Pushkar, a visit to Savitri Temple is a must. Located atop Ratnagiri Hill, reaching the temple involves a scenic hike or a convenient ropeway ride. The views from the top are simply stunning, particularly at sunrise or sunset, offering a complete vista of Pushkar Lake and the surrounding landscape. 8. Experience the Pushkar Camel Fair (if visiting in November)
If you are visiting Pushkar in November, experiencing the Pushkar Camel Fair is a must. It is among the most significant camel fairs globally, attracting traders and tourists alike. You'll see thousands of camels adorned in vibrant colors, participating in beauty contests, races, and trade shows. Beyond camels, the fair includes cultural performances, music, dance, and various stalls selling handicrafts, textiles, and local delicacies. It's a sensory overload and a fantastic opportunity to immerse yourself in Rajasthani culture. Furthermore, don't miss out on the opportunity to witness traditional wrestling matches and other local sports. 10. Explore the Rose Gardens of Pushkar
Escape the bustle of Pushkar and immerse yourself in the fragrant beauty of its rose gardens. Pushkar is famous for its roses, and a visit to these gardens offers a sensory delight. Stroll through rows of vibrant blooms, inhaling the sweet aroma and marveling at the various colors. These gardens supply roses for perfumes, rose water, and gulkand, a traditional Indian sweet.
